Mix the foundation with a face cream. (I'd say maybe a 70% cream 30% foundation)
Just put it on like you would any face cream. The coverage will be minimal, but it won't look orange and it evens things out a bit. (Also, not as thick.)
If you're unsatisfied with it, just dust a bit of your powder over top during the day.
Or, if your have the funds, consider getting new makeup.
Any mineral powder will look really natural, and it won't clog your pores or feel heavy.
However, they make up doesn't stay on very long and it (in my experience) doesn't do a helluva lot of covering.
Try a tinted face cream, a much lighter shade of foundation (remember, if it's too pale, a dust of bronzer can fix that in a jiffy) or even try using a stick cover up for the specific spots and lightly blend it in all over.
All in all it will take some searching until you find the face make up that works best for you.
